| Description | 2-(2,8-Dihydroxy-8,8a-dimethyl-3,7-dioxo-1,2,3,7,8,8a-hexahydronaphthalen-2-yl)prop-2-en-1-yl acetate belongs to the class of organic compounds known as eremophilane, 8,9-secoeremophilane and furoeremophilane sesquiterpenoids. These are sesquiterpenoids with a structure based either on the eremophilane skeleton, its 8,9-seco derivative, or the furoeremophilane skeleton. Eremophilanes have been shown to be derived from eudesmanes by migration of the methyl group at C-10 to C-5. 2-(2,8-dihydroxy-8,8a-dimethyl-3,7-dioxo-1h-naphthalen-2-yl)prop-2-en-1-yl acetate is found in Albatrellus ellisii.
